The asset utilization indicator refers to the revenue earned for every dollar of assets a company currently reports. Civitas Resources has an asset utilization ratio of 34.81 percent. This signifies that the Company is making $0.35 for each dollar of assets. We calculate exposure to Civitas Resources's market risk, different technical and fundamental indicators, and relevant financial multiples and ratios and then compare them to those of Civitas Resources's related companies.Civitas Resources, Inc., an exploration and production company, focuses on the acquisition, development, and production of oil and natural gas in the Rocky Mountain region, primarily in the Wattenberg Field of the Denver-Julesburg Basin of Colorado. Civitas Resources, Inc. was founded in 1999 and is based in Denver, Colorado. Civitas Resources operates under Oil Gas EP classification in the United States and is traded on New York Stock Exchange. It employs 322 people.

Civitas Resources Dividends Analysis For Valuation
There are various types of dividends Civitas Resources can pay to its shareholders, and the actual value of the dividend is determined on a per-share basis. It is to be paid equally to all of Civitas shareholders on a specific date, known as the payable date. The cash dividend is the most common type of dividend payment - it is the payment of actual cash from Civitas Resources directly to its shareholders. There are other types of dividends that companies can issue, such as stock dividends or asset dividends. When Civitas pays a dividend, it has no impact on its enterprise value. It does, however, lowers the Equity Value of Civitas Resources by the value of the dividends paid out.
